Output 148784c81e45534bd0e6f15c7f4a6e80ab0bf0456627f860d0cac0e3a5cdcbb9:3

value
1137485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e8be1ebbfc63966f6ce3ece1d194b8f4ee0bb7a OP_EQUAL
address
3DE8dvNtyX342XEgikDZoxFBRJNMBbJsfE
transaction
148784c81e45534bd0e6f15c7f4a6e80ab0bf0456627f860d0cac0e3a5cdcbb9
confirmations
288979
spent
true